Analisis Critical Success Factor Kinerja Pelaksanaan Pekerjaan Perkerasan Aspal Jalan Provinsi Sumatera Utara di Kabupaten Mandailing Natal
Critical Success Factor Analysis of Asphalt Pavement Works of North Sumatera Province Roads in Mandailing Natal Regency
Abstract
Early damage to the asphalt surface layer of the road is often found in road construction before the end of the planned life. Excessive axle load of heavy goods vehicles is the cause of damage that is always conveyed by road organizers, but the facts in the field show that there are other causes that are not disclosed, namely that the implementing contractor does not comply with the application of specifications, the use of materials that are not of the appropriate quality, and the equipment used does not function properly in the field. This is the basis for this study to analyze the Critical Success Factor (CSF), identify CSFs that have a significant effect on the success of the implementation of asphalt paving work on North Sumatra Province roads in Mandailing Natal Regency and analyze the effect of CSFs on the achievement of performance indicators. The Partial Least Square - Structural Equation Modeling (PLS-SEM) analysis method is used in this study to analyze the CSF performance of the implementation of asphalt paving work on North Sumatra Province roads in Mandailing Natal Regency. This analysis method uses the help of Smart PLS software. PLS-SEM is more suitable for developing exploratory research that has limited theory development and PLS-SEM is also more suitable for use if the research data is ordinal (eg: Likert scale) and nominal and ignores normally distributed data (nonparametric). The results of the analysis show that the Critical Success Factor that has an impact on the success of the implementation of asphalt paving work on North Sumatra Province roads in Mandailing Natal Regency is the supervision factor with a value of 0.406 having the greatest impact. Other factors such as labor factors (0.281), environmental standard factors (0.228), quality test standard factors (0.214), equipment factors (0.176) have a moderate impact, while design error factors (0.109), material factors (0.088), work method factors (0.026) have a small impact. On the other hand, the factors that significantly influence the success of the implementation of asphalt paving work on North Sumatra Province roads in Mandailing Natal Regency in achieving performance indicators are the work method factor (X4), the quality test standard factor (X5), the environmental standard factor (X6), the supervision factor (X7), and the design error factor (X8). Overall, the Critical Success Factor factors for the performance of asphalt paving work implementation on North Sumatra provincial roads in Mandailing Natal Regency showed that they did not have much influence on the success in achieving performance indicators with a value of 15.3% due to the low influence of material factors, work method factors, and design error factors.
